A delightful hotel, must have been a charming family home. Surprised it is called Grey Walls because it’s built in Cotswold coloured Stone. The gardens delightful. Unfortunately all that was available to book were the two caddy rooms. Adequate but only just.
Excellent service, brilliant location for golf at Muirfield, worth paying for larger rooms as caddys closet was slightly tired and noisy from water running
Smallest single room I’ve chosen. Single bed was fine. Overall room felt a bit dated but functional for one nite only. Reasonable toiletries provided. Room had no coffee/tea making facilities which may seem trivial but as a single traveller it’s sometimes nice to have the option in your own space. Staff friendly and accommodating. Coffee available in communal areas. Traditional breakfast was fine and as expected. Location very good for golf lovers.
